Description
The GE DS200DMCBG1AED and its later iteration, the DS215DMCBG1AZZ03A, are high-performance Drive Control and LAN Communication boards (DMCB). These modules are integral to the Speedtronic™ Mark V Turbine Control System and the DIRECTO-MATIC™ 2000 (DC2000) drive family. They provide a sophisticated interface for data processing, operator interaction, and high-speed network communication in gas, steam, and wind turbine applications.
While the DS200 version represents the original hardware design, the DS215 version (indicated by the “215” prefix) is a “Form, Fit, and Function” replacement that often includes updated circuitry, improved surface-mount components, and specific firmware enhancements to ensure compatibility with modern system revisions.
Product Parameters (Datasheet)
Both boards utilize a multi-microprocessor architecture to handle control and communication tasks simultaneously without latency.

| Parameter | Specification |
| Model Number | DS200DMCBG1AED / DS215DMCBG1AZZ03A |
| Primary Processor (DUP) | Intel 80C186 @ 33 MHz |
| LAN Processor (LUP) | Intel 80C196 @ 15.667 MHz |
| Keyboard Processor (KUP) | Intel 80C196 @ 11.059 MHz |
| Number of Channels | 12 (Dedicated analog/digital paths) |
| Communication Protocols | DLAN, DLAN+ (ARCNET), RS-232C |
| Optional Interfaces | Genius LAN, DS200IOEA I/O Expansion |
| Analog Output Current | 0-20 mA |
| Operating Voltage | 115/230V AC (Via auxiliary supply) or 24V DC Internal |
| Operating Temperature | -30°C to +65°C |
| Diagnostic Display | LED indicators & alphanumeric keypad interface support |
| Protection | Onboard fuses and voltage-limiting resistors/diodes |
Technical Features & Architecture
- Multi-Processor Logic: The DUP (Dominant Microprocessor) executes the primary drive control algorithms and application code, while the LUP handles the heavy lifting of network communications (DLAN/DLAN+), ensuring process data is shared across the control ring without interrupting motor logic.
- Firmware Sophistication: The DS215DMCBG1AZZ03A is typically pre-loaded with specific firmware (AZZ03A) designed to support advanced excitation and drive control features, including expanded I/O mapping.
- Network Versatility: Supports multiple LAN topologies. When equipped with optional daughterboards, it can interface with the Genius LAN protocol for distributed I/O control.
- Robust Protection: The board is populated with protective fuses and blue-colored drum-style electrolytic capacitors for voltage filtering and surge suppression, safeguarding the module from momentary power fluctuations.

Installation & Maintenance Guidelines
- ESD Protection: These boards are highly populated with sensitive integrated circuits (ICs). Always use an anti-static wrist strap and handle the board only by its edges.
- Jumper Configuration: The DS200DMCB series contains over 20 hardware jumpers. These must be meticulously verified against the original board’s settings before power-up, as they define signal levels, bus addresses, and watchdog timers.
- Fuse Verification: If the board stops functioning after a power surge, check the two onboard fuses. Only replace them with fuses of the exact same rating to prevent component damage.
- Connector Integrity: The board features several 26-pin and 40-pin connectors. Ensure cables are fully seated and that the cable strain relief is used to prevent vibration-induced signal loss.
Recommended Related GE Mark V / DC2000 Products
To maintain a complete Speedtronic Mark V or DC2000 drive system, the following related components are frequently utilized:
- DS200IOEA: Input/Output Expansion Interface board used to increase the I/O capacity of the DMCB.
- DS200ADGI: Auxiliary Interface board providing additional signal conditioning for turbine sensors.
- DS200DPCB: Power Connect Board used to distribute AC/DC power within the drive cabinet.
- DS200LDCCH1A: Drive Control / LAN Communications board (often used in earlier or parallel architectures).
- IS200STCIH1A: Terminal Board for I/O signal termination and surge protection.
- DS200SDCC: Drive Control card often paired with the DMCB in EX2000 excitation systems.
